Hip Hop Producer 9th Wonder to Speak at Barton on November 9th
· In News
WILSON, N.C. — Barton College’s Mass Communications Club is pleased to present a screening of hip hop producer 9th Wonder’s new documentary “The Wonder Year,” a film by Kenneth Price. Scheduled for Wednesday, Nov. 9, at 6:30 p.m. in Hardy Alumni Hall, this event is open to the public free of charge, and the community is invited to attend.
The evening event will begin with a lecture by 9th Wonder (Patrick Douthit) followed by the film screening of his documentary. There will be time for a Question and Answer Session following the screening.
The film documents a year in the life of 9th Wonder, a CEO, NAACP ambassador, Duke University visiting instructor, husband, father, son, and Grammy award-winning producer. The film features Drake, DJ Premier, DJ Green Lantern, J. Cole, Murs, Phonte, Shar Money XL, young Guru, The Alchemist, and more.
Among those with whom 9th Wonder has worked are Little Brother, Lil Wayne, Drake, Jay-Z, Murs, Mary J. Blige, Chris Brown, Destiny’s Child, David Banner, Erykah Badu, and Ludacris, just to name a few.
